本文目录导读:
随着互联网技术的飞速发展,区域门户网站已成为各地区信息传播的重要平台,一个优秀的区域门户网站不仅能够为当地居民提供便捷的服务,还能推动地方经济发展,本文将从技术层面解析区域门户网站源码,并探讨优化策略,以期为广大开发者提供参考。
图片来源于网络,如有侵权联系删除
区域门户网站源码技术解析
1、框架与技术选型
区域门户网站源码通常采用主流的Web开发框架,如Java的Spring Boot、PHP的Laravel、Python的Django等,这些框架具有丰富的功能模块和良好的扩展性,能够满足网站开发的需求。
2、数据库设计
数据库是区域门户网站的核心组成部分,其设计直接影响到网站的性能和稳定性,常见的数据库有MySQL、Oracle、SQL Server等,在设计数据库时,应遵循以下原则:
(1)规范化设计:确保数据库表结构清晰,避免数据冗余。
(2)合理分区:根据业务需求对数据库进行分区,提高查询效率。
(3)索引优化:合理设置索引,提高数据查询速度。
3、前端技术
前端技术主要包括HTML、CSS、JavaScript等,在区域门户网站开发中,前端技术应遵循以下原则:
(1)响应式设计:适应不同设备屏幕,提升用户体验。
(2)简洁明了:保持界面简洁,避免信息过载。
(3)高效加载:优化图片、CSS、JavaScript等资源,提高页面加载速度。
图片来源于网络,如有侵权联系删除
4、后端技术
后端技术主要包括服务器端语言、框架、中间件等,在区域门户网站开发中,后端技术应遵循以下原则:
(1)模块化设计:将业务逻辑划分为独立的模块,便于维护和扩展。
(2)安全性:加强数据安全防护,防止SQL注入、XSS攻击等安全风险。
(3)性能优化:合理配置服务器资源,提高网站响应速度。
区域门户网站源码优化策略
1、代码优化
(1)遵循编码规范:统一代码风格,提高代码可读性和可维护性。
(2)优化算法:针对关键业务场景,优化算法,提高性能。
(3)代码复用:合理复用代码,降低开发成本。
2、数据库优化
(1)合理索引:根据查询需求,设置合理的索引,提高查询效率。
(2)优化查询语句:避免复杂的查询语句,简化SQL语句,提高执行速度。
图片来源于网络,如有侵权联系删除
(3)分区策略:根据业务需求,合理分区数据库,提高性能。
3、前端优化
(1)图片优化:压缩图片,减少图片大小,提高页面加载速度。
(2)CSS、JavaScript合并:合并CSS、JavaScript文件,减少HTTP请求次数。
(3)懒加载:对于非关键资源,采用懒加载技术,提高页面加载速度。
4、服务器优化
(1)负载均衡:合理配置服务器资源,实现负载均衡,提高网站稳定性。
(2)缓存策略:设置合理的缓存策略,减少数据库访问次数,提高响应速度。
(3)服务器安全:加强服务器安全防护,防止黑客攻击。
区域门户网站源码是网站开发的重要基础,了解其技术架构和优化策略对于提升网站性能和用户体验具有重要意义,本文从技术层面解析了区域门户网站源码,并提出了优化策略,希望对广大开发者有所帮助。
标签: #区域门户网站源码
评论列表